He was born Oct. 18, 1950, to Edmund and Theresa (Morin) Dickman in Hays.
He was a field agent for Knights of Columbus.
He is survived by his wife, Rebecca, of the home; a daughter, Lisa Oritz and husband Reyes of Las Banos, Calif.; two sons, Jason Dickman of Wichita, and Adam Dickman of Ft. Campbell, Ky.; and a brother, Bernard Dickman and his wife Karen of Grinnell.
Visitation will be 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. Friday at Baalmann Mortuary, 190 S. Franklin in Colby, and 4 to 8 p.m. at St. Paul's Catholic Church in Angelus, with a 7:30 p.m. rosary. Funeral will begin at 10 a.m. Saturday at St. Paul's Catholic Church, Angelus. Burial will follow in St. Paul's Catholic Cemetery, Angelus.
Memorials are suggested to Sixth Street AA and Sacred Heart Catholic School at Colby, both in care of Baalmann Mortuary, Box 391, Colby, KS 67701
Garden City Telegram, July 25, 2012
